perf trace-event: Avoid double free and leak in trace_event__cleanup()/trace_event__init()
trace_event__cleanup() frees t->pevent but never clears the pointer. It can be called twice on the same trace_event: once from trace_report()'s error path, and again from perf_session__delete() during session teardown, resulting in a double free / use-after-free. Separately, trace_event__init() overwrites t->pevent/t->plugin_list without releasing any existing handle, leaking memory if it's called more than once on the same struct. eg. via a perf.data file with multiple PERF_RECORD_HEADER_TRACING_DATA headers. Guard against re-entry by returning early if t->pevent is already NULL, and clear it after cleanup so a repeat call is a safe no-op. Call trace_event__cleanup() at the start of trace_event__init(), so a repeated init releases any existing handle before allocating a new one. diff --git a/tools/perf/util/trace-event.c b/tools/perf/util/trace-event.c
index 6a8c66c64b70..000c1e1d68c1 100644
--- a/tools/perf/util/trace-event.c
+++ b/tools/perf/util/trace-event.c
@@ -26,7 +26,11 @@ static bool tevent_initialized;
int trace_event__init(struct trace_event *t)
{
- struct tep_handle *pevent = tep_alloc();
+ struct tep_handle *pevent;
+
+ trace_event__cleanup(t);
+
+ pevent = tep_alloc();
if (pevent) {
t->plugin_list = tep_load_plugins(pevent);
@@ -63,8 +67,13 @@ int trace_event__register_resolver(struct machine *machine,
void trace_event__cleanup(struct trace_event *t)
{
+ if (!t->pevent)
+ return;
+
tep_unload_plugins(t->plugin_list, t->pevent);
tep_free(t->pevent);
+ t->pevent = NULL;
+ t->plugin_list = NULL;
}
